6.2.2.2 Process calibration
1. Select PROCESS CAL and press Enter.
2. Slope: XXX.XX is displayed. Enter the slope value of the process solution. Press
Enter to confirm.
3. After measurement the concentration of the process solution is displayed CONC
1/2 XX.XXEXX. This value can be adjusted if necessary. Press Enter to confirm.
6.2.2.3 Automatic calibration
This is only available if the analyzer has this option installed. It allows for an automatic
calibration at pre-programmed intervals, using a calibration solution of known
concentration.
1. Select AUTOMAT. CAL and press Enter.
2. FREQUENCY is displayed. This defines the number of measurements that are made
before an automatic calibration takes place. Enter the number and confirm with
Enter.
3. If the AUTOMAT CAL1 PT option has been selected:
Option Description
INJ. TIME Enter the injection time of the calibration solution in seconds and confirm with
Enter.
CONC Enter the concentration of the calibration solution and press Enter.
IMMEDIATE Select YES or NO followed by Enter. If YES is selected an automatic
calibration will start immediately. No more input is required.
4. If the AUTOMAT CAL 2PTS option has been selected, select CAL PUMP YES to
start a pump calibration (pulse or micro system), CAL PUMP NO if no calibration is
required or Use Default Parameters to use the parameters defined in PMXXX-
OPTION-AUTOMAT.CAL and press Enter.
5. If the CAL PUMP YES option has been selected:
Option Description
INJ.TIME or
INJECT
Enter the injection time (micro system pump) in seconds or the number
of pulses (pulse pump) and press Enter.
ADD C Enter the concentration of the addition and press Enter. The pump
calibration starts.
Fill C. PUMP SOL Press Enter for the introduction of the solution with known
concentration. The concentration of the solution in the measurement
chamber is then measured, followed by an injection of the calibration
solution, followed by another measurement of the solution in the
measurement chamber.
